Technical Roadmap & Material Science

Sub-Micro Grain Substrate

The foundation of a superior 0.5mm end mill lies in its grain structure. We utilize tungsten carbide with grain sizes below 0.5μm, ensuring a perfect balance between hardness (HRA 92+) and transverse rupture strength.

Advanced PVD Coatings

For micro-tools, coating thickness is critical. Our AlTiN and AlCrN coatings are applied using HiPIMS technology, providing a smooth surface that reduces friction and prevents BUE (Built-Up Edge) during high-speed machining.

Precision Geometry

0.5mm tools require optimized flute depths and helix angles (typically 30° to 45°) to ensure chip removal without compromising the structural integrity of the narrow tool neck.

Micro End Mill FAQ & Technical Guidance

Why does my 0.5mm micro end mill keep breaking?
Tool breakage at 0.5mm is usually caused by excessive runout (TIR), improper chip evacuation, or incorrect feed rates. Ensure your spindle runout is under 0.003mm and consider using air blast or high-pressure coolant to clear chips.
What is the optimal RPM for a 0.5mm Tungsten Carbide tool?
Micro-machining requires high surface speeds. For a 0.5mm tool in steel, you may need spindle speeds ranging from 20,000 to 60,000 RPM, depending on the material hardness and coating.
